Brownie "martinis" – a delicious recipe with Kahlua, brownies, vanilla ice cream, fresh raspberry, caramel sauce. Easy to follow and perfect for any occasion.

Fill the bottom of a double-boiler half full of hot water.
2
Place over medium-high heat and bring to a boil.
3
Pour the hot fudge sauce into the top half and stirring occasionally, heat long enough to melt.
4
Do not bring to a simmer.
5
One at a time, dip each martini glass into the chocolate to coat the rim and twirl several times to coat.
6
Allow the excess to drip off.
7
Place each glass on a small serving saucer and set aside at room temperature.
8
Stir the Kahlua into the remaining hot fudge sauce.
9
Cut each brownie into 4 small pieces and place on a microwave-plate.
10
When you are ready to finish off the desert, heat the brownies just along enough to warm.
11
Place 2 pieces in each glass and top first with a small scoop of ice cream or gelato and then the warm fudge sauce.
12
Garnish with the fresh raspberries and drizzles of caramel sauce.
